The Urgent Need for Island-Specific Solutions
East African islands face unique challenges:
- Heavy reliance on imported fossil fuels (up to 90% in some regions)
- Limited grid connectivity between islands
- High vulnerability to climate change impacts
Technology Driving the Change
The project combines three innovative approaches:
1. Hybrid Battery Systems
By pairing lithium-ion batteries with flow battery technology, these systems achieve both rapid response (30ms) and long-duration storage (8-12 hours). A recent pilot in Mauritius demonstrated 40% cost reduction compared to traditional diesel setups.
2. AI-Powered Energy Management
Machine learning algorithms predict energy demand patterns with 92% accuracy, optimizing storage deployment. This smart grid technology has reduced energy waste by 18% in Zanzibar's test phase.
3. Modular Microgrid Solutions
Containerized storage units enable rapid deployment across multiple islands. Each 40ft container can power 150 households for 6 hours – perfect for archipelagos like Seychelles.
Case Study: Pemba Island Transformation
Metric | Before | After |
---|---|---|
Energy Costs | $0.38/kWh | $0.14/kWh |
Renewable Penetration | 12% | 68% |
Grid Stability | 4 outages/month | 0.2 outages/month |

FAQs: Island Energy Storage Solutions
How long do these storage systems last?
Modern systems typically maintain 80% capacity after 10 years of daily cycling.
What maintenance is required?
Remote monitoring handles 90% of maintenance needs, with annual physical inspections.
Can existing diesel systems integrate with storage?
Yes! Hybrid systems allow gradual transition, reducing upfront costs by 25-40%.
